Understanding SQL Accounting Software
SQL accounting software operates on the principle of utilizing a relational database management system to store, manage, and retrieve financial data. Unlike traditional spreadsheet-based methods, SQL Payroll Software offers a structured approach to data management, ensuring data integrity and consistency across various modules and transactions.
At its core, SQL accounting software comprises modules for general ledger, accounts payable, accounts receivable, payroll, inventory management, and reporting. Each module seamlessly integrates with the others, facilitating real-time data updates and comprehensive financial analysis.

What Defines a Truly Secure Website?
In today's digital landscape, a website is often the front door to a business, a personal brand, or vital information. With cyber threats constantly evolving, the question isn't just "Is my website online?" but "Is my website truly secure?" Many users look for the padlock icon and "HTTPS" in the address bar and breathe a sigh of relief. While essential, that green lock is merely the beginning of true website security.
HTTPS signifies that the connection between your browser and the website's server is encrypted, protecting data in transit. But a truly secure website goes far beyond encrypting data between two points. It's built on a multi-layered defense strategy, addressing vulnerabilities at every level of the application and infrastructure.
So, what are the characteristics of a website you can genuinely trust?
1. Always Uses HTTPS with Strong TLS Protocols
This is the foundational layer, but its proper implementation is crucial.
What it is: HTTPS (Hypertext Transfer Protocol Secure) encrypts the communication between the user's browser and the website's server using TLS (Transport Layer Security, the modern successor to SSL) certificates.
Why it's essential: It prevents eavesdropping, tampering, and message forgery, ensuring that the data you send (like login credentials or credit card numbers) and receive remains private and integral. Modern browsers flag sites without HTTPS as "Not Secure." Crucially, truly secure websites use strong, up-to-date TLS versions (like TLS 1.2 or 1.3), not older, vulnerable ones.
2. Robust Input Validation and Output Encoding
These are fundamental defenses against some of the most common web attacks.
Input Validation: Every piece of data a user submits (forms, search queries, URLs) must be strictly validated before the server processes it. This prevents attackers from injecting malicious code (e.g., SQL Injection, Command Injection) that could manipulate the database or execute commands on the server.
Output Encoding: Any data retrieved from a database or user input that is displayed back on the website must be properly encoded. This prevents Cross-Site Scripting (XSS) attacks, where malicious scripts could be executed in a user's browser, stealing cookies or defacing the site.
3. Strong Authentication & Authorization Mechanisms
Security starts with knowing who is accessing your site and what they are allowed to do.
Authentication:
Strong Password Policies: Enforce minimum length, complexity (mix of characters), and disallow common or previously breached passwords.
Multi-Factor Authentication (MFA): Offer and ideally mandate MFA for all user accounts, especially administrative ones. This adds a critical layer of security beyond just a password.
Secure Session Management: Use secure, short-lived session tokens, implement proper session timeouts, and regenerate session IDs upon privilege escalation to prevent session hijacking.
Authorization: Implement the principle of least privilege. Users should only have access to the data and functionalities strictly necessary for their role. Role-Based Access Control (RBAC) is key here, ensuring a customer can't access admin features, for instance.
4. Regular Security Updates & Patch Management
Software is complex, and vulnerabilities are constantly discovered.
Continuous Patching: The website's underlying operating system, web server software (e.g., Apache, Nginx), Content Management System (CMS) like WordPress or Drupal, plugins, themes, and all third-party libraries must be kept up-to-date with the latest security patches.
Why it's essential: Unpatched vulnerabilities are a common entry point for attackers. A truly secure website has a rigorous system for identifying and applying updates swiftly.
5. Comprehensive Error Handling & Logging
What happens when things go wrong, or suspicious activity occurs?
Generic Error Messages: Error messages should be generic and not reveal sensitive system information (e.g., database connection strings, file paths, or specific error codes) that attackers could use to map your system.
Robust Logging: All security-relevant events – failed login attempts, successful logins, administrative actions, suspicious requests, and critical system events – should be logged. These logs should be stored securely, centrally, and monitored in real-time by a Security Information and Event Management (SIEM) system for anomalies and potential attacks.
6. Secure Development Practices (SDL)
Security isn't an afterthought; it's built in from the ground up.
Security by Design: A truly secure website is born from a development process where security considerations are embedded at every stage – from initial design and architecture to coding, testing, and deployment. This is known as a Secure Development Lifecycle (SDL).
Code Reviews & Testing: Regular security code reviews, static application security testing (SAST), and dynamic application security testing (DAST) are performed to identify and fix vulnerabilities before the code ever goes live.
7. Web Application Firewall (WAF)
A WAF acts as a protective shield for your website.
What it does: It monitors and filters HTTP traffic between the web application and the internet. It can detect and block common web-based attacks (like SQL injection, XSS, DDoS, brute-force attempts) before they reach the application.
Why it helps: It provides an additional layer of defense, especially useful for mitigating new threats before a patch is available or for protecting against known vulnerabilities.
8. Data Encryption at Rest
While HTTPS encrypts data in transit, data stored on servers needs protection too.
Sensitive Data Encryption: Databases, file systems, and backups containing sensitive user information (passwords, PII, financial data) should be encrypted.
Why it's important: Even if an attacker manages to breach your server and access the underlying storage, the data remains unreadable without the encryption key, significantly mitigating the impact of a breach.
9. Regular Security Audits & Penetration Testing
Proactive testing is key to finding weaknesses before malicious actors do.
Vulnerability Scanning: Automated tools scan your website for known vulnerabilities.
Penetration Testing (Pen-Testing): Ethical hackers simulate real-world attacks to exploit vulnerabilities, test your defenses, and assess your overall security posture. These should be conducted regularly and after significant changes to the website.
10. Clear Privacy Policy & Data Handling Transparency
While not a strictly technical security feature, transparency builds user trust and demonstrates responsible data stewardship.
What it includes: A clear, easily accessible privacy policy explaining what data is collected, why it's collected, how it's used, how it's protected, and who it's shared with.
Why it matters: It shows commitment to data security and respects user privacy, a fundamental aspect of a truly trustworthy online presence.
A truly secure website is not a static state achieved by checking a few boxes. It's a continuous commitment to vigilance, proactive measures, and a deep understanding that security is an ongoing process involving people, technology, and robust policies. In a world where digital trust is paramount, building and maintaining a genuinely secure website is an investment that pays dividends in reputation, customer loyalty, and business continuity.

DBMS Tutorial Explained: Concepts, Types, and Applications

In today’s digital world, data is everywhere — from social media posts and financial records to healthcare systems and e-commerce websites. But have you ever wondered how all that data is stored, organized, and managed? That’s where DBMS — or Database Management System — comes into play.
Whether you’re a student, software developer, aspiring data analyst, or just someone curious about how information is handled behind the scenes, this DBMS tutorial is your one-stop guide. We’ll explore the fundamental concepts, various types of DBMS, and real-world applications to help you understand how modern databases function.
What is a DBMS?
A Database Management System (DBMS) is software that enables users to store, retrieve, manipulate, and manage data efficiently. Think of it as an interface between the user and the database. Rather than interacting directly with raw data, users and applications communicate with the database through the DBMS.
For example, when you check your bank account balance through an app, it’s the DBMS that processes your request, fetches the relevant data, and sends it back to your screen — all in milliseconds.
Why Learn DBMS?
Understanding DBMS is crucial because:
It’s foundational to software development: Every application that deals with data — from mobile apps to enterprise systems — relies on some form of database.
It improves data accuracy and security: DBMS helps in organizing data logically while controlling access and maintaining integrity.
It’s highly relevant for careers in tech: Knowledge of DBMS is essential for roles in backend development, data analysis, database administration, and more.
Core Concepts of DBMS
Let’s break down some of the fundamental concepts that every beginner should understand when starting with DBMS.
1. Database
A database is an organized collection of related data. Instead of storing information in random files, a database stores data in structured formats like tables, making retrieval efficient and logical.
2. Data Models
Data models define how data is logically structured. The most common models include:
Hierarchical Model
Network Model
Relational Model
Object-Oriented Model
Among these, the Relational Model (used in systems like MySQL, PostgreSQL, and Oracle) is the most popular today.
3. Schemas and Tables
A schema defines the structure of a database — like a blueprint. It includes definitions of tables, columns, data types, and relationships between tables.
4. SQL (Structured Query Language)
SQL is the standard language used to communicate with relational DBMS. It allows users to perform operations like:
SELECT: Retrieve data
INSERT: Add new data
UPDATE: Modify existing data
DELETE: Remove data
5. Normalization
Normalization is the process of organizing data to reduce redundancy and improve integrity. It involves dividing a database into two or more related tables and defining relationships between them.
6. Transactions
A transaction is a sequence of operations performed as a single logical unit. Transactions in DBMS follow ACID properties — Atomicity, Consistency, Isolation, and Durability — ensuring reliable data processing even during failures.
Types of DBMS
DBMS can be categorized into several types based on how data is stored and accessed:
1. Hierarchical DBMS
Organizes data in a tree-like structure.
Each parent can have multiple children, but each child has only one parent.
Example: IBM’s IMS.
2. Network DBMS
Data is represented as records connected through links.
More flexible than hierarchical model; a child can have multiple parents.
Example: Integrated Data Store (IDS).
3. Relational DBMS (RDBMS)
Data is stored in tables (relations) with rows and columns.
Uses SQL for data manipulation.
Most widely used type today.
Examples: MySQL, PostgreSQL, Oracle, SQL Server.
4. Object-Oriented DBMS (OODBMS)
Data is stored in the form of objects, similar to object-oriented programming.
Supports complex data types and relationships.
Example: db4o, ObjectDB.
5. NoSQL DBMS
Designed for handling unstructured or semi-structured data.
Ideal for big data applications.
Types include document, key-value, column-family, and graph databases.
Examples: MongoDB, Cassandra, Redis, Neo4j.

PHP, LAMP (Linux Apache MySQL PHP)
The LAMP stack — Linux, Apache, MySQL, and PHP — has been a cornerstone of web development for over two decades. It’s an open-source suite of software components that work together to serve dynamic websites and web applications. Among these, PHP plays a central role, acting as the scripting language responsible for generating dynamic page content. Despite the rise of modern development stacks like MERN or JAMstack, LAMP remains a reliable, accessible, and widely used platform for developers around the world.
What is LAMP?
LAMP is an acronym that stands for:
Linux: The operating system.
Apache: The web server software.
MySQL: The relational database management system.
PHP: The server-side scripting language.
Each component of LAMP is free and open-source, which contributed to its massive adoption in the early 2000s. Even today, LAMP powers a significant portion of the web, including popular platforms like WordPress, Drupal, and Joomla.
PHP: The Dynamic Power of LAMP
PHP (Hypertext Preprocessor) is the scripting language used in LAMP to process user requests and generate dynamic content. It integrates seamlessly with HTML, making it easy for developers to embed logic within web pages. PHP scripts are executed on the server, and the output is sent to the client’s browser in the form of standard HTML.
PHP supports a vast range of features including form handling, file management, database access, and session tracking. It’s easy to learn for beginners, yet powerful enough to build complex web applications. PHP is constantly evolving, with the latest versions offering improved performance, better error handling, and strong security features.
The Role of Each Component in LAMP
Here’s a breakdown of how each element in the LAMP stack functions together:
1. Linux
Linux acts as the foundation for the LAMP stack. It’s known for its stability, flexibility, and security. Most servers run on some version of Linux because of its ability to handle high volumes of traffic and customizable nature. Common Linux distributions used in LAMP setups include Ubuntu, CentOS, and Debian.
2. Apache
Apache is a powerful and flexible open-source web server that handles HTTP requests from users’ browsers. It is responsible for delivering web pages to the client and includes modules for URL rewriting, authentication, and more. Apache can be customized using .htaccess files, making it easy to manage server behavior for specific directories.
3. MySQL
MySQL is a robust relational database management system used to store and manage application data. From user accounts to blog posts, all information can be efficiently queried and updated using SQL (Structured Query Language). PHP and MySQL often work hand in hand, with PHP scripts using MySQL queries to interact with the database.
4. PHP
PHP pulls it all together by connecting the front-end interface with the back-end logic. Whether it’s fetching blog posts from a database or processing user input from a form, PHP makes the content dynamic and personalized. PHP also supports object-oriented programming, error handling, and integration with third-party libraries.

What is Forensic Accounting?
Forensic accounting is the practice of using accounting, auditing, and investigative skills to examine financial records and uncover fraud, embezzlement, or other financial misconduct. It plays a critical role in both preventing and responding to white-collar crime.
Whether it’s tracing illegal funds, identifying accounting irregularities, or presenting findings in legal proceedings, forensic accountants are trusted allies of law enforcement agencies, banks, corporations, and even courts.
Why Is It So Important Today?
The corporate world has witnessed scandals that shook entire economies — think Enron, Satyam, or the more recent Yes Bank and DHFL cases in India. In each of these, financial misreporting, siphoning of funds, and manipulation of accounts were at the core.
Here’s why forensic accounting matters more than ever:
Rising corporate frauds: With digital transactions and complex financial instruments, fraudsters are getting more sophisticated.
Regulatory scrutiny: Governments and regulatory bodies like SEBI, RBI, and ED are tightening oversight.
Investor protection: Accurate financial reporting is crucial to safeguard investor trust and market stability.
What Do Forensic Accountants Actually Do?
Here are some core responsibilities:
🔍 Investigate Fraudulent Transactions
Analyze bank statements, ledgers, and emails to uncover unauthorized or suspicious financial activity.
🧾 Audit Financial Statements
Detect inconsistencies, inflated revenues, or disguised liabilities in financial reports.
💼 Litigation Support
Provide expert witness testimony and build case files for legal proceedings related to fraud.
💡 Digital Forensics
Use software tools and data analytics to extract and interpret hidden or deleted information.
🔐 Risk Mitigation
Design internal control systems to prevent fraud before it happens.
Real-World Examples of Forensic Accounting in Action
🏦 The Satyam Scandal (India)
In one of India’s biggest corporate frauds, forensic accountants helped uncover how ₹7,000+ crore was falsely shown as cash on Satyam’s balance sheet. The scandal reshaped India’s corporate governance framework.
💰 Nirav Modi–PNB Fraud
Forensic audits played a vital role in identifying how fraudulent Letters of Undertaking (LoUs) worth nearly ₹14,000 crore were issued.
🌍 Enron Scandal (USA)
Investigators revealed how Enron used accounting loopholes and special purpose entities to hide debt and inflate profits.
